DAVIDSON v. SHARP

No. 4575.

101 So.2d 465 (1958)

Joseph K. DAVIDSON et al. v. Isaac W. SHARP.

Court of Appeal of Louisiana, First Circuit.

March 17, 1958.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Philip S. Finn, Jr., New Orleans, for appellants.

Reid & Macy, Hammond, for appellee.


LOTTINGER, Judge.

The parties to this litigation own adjoining properties in the Southwest Quarter of Section Twenty-six, Township Eight South, Range Six East, in the Parish of Livingston. Alleging that they were entitled to a judicial fixing of the boundaries between the two properties, the plaintiff filed a boundary suit in consequence of which Mr. Oliver C. Hollister, C.
